Tucson, AZ (January 24, 2026) – Emergency crews responded to a vehicle accident with injuries late Friday night, January 23, at the intersection of East Golf Links Road and South Swan Road in Tucson.
The crash was reported at approximately 10:31 p.m., with units arriving on scene by 10:38 p.m., according to incident tracking from AZ511. The collision caused injuries, though the number of individuals involved and the severity of those injuries have not yet been released.
The accident occurred on January 23 in a busy corridor on Tucson’s east side, where high traffic volumes during evening hours often increase the risk of collisions. Responders worked to assist victims and manage the scene for over an hour before the area was cleared.
Authorities continue to investigate the cause of the accident. Additional updates may be provided as more details become available. Our thoughts are with those injured in this incident.
